Transaction 81849c052629809bc95ea2194af31e59a95b3e77b9fd7f4eec3ce849a23b9643
1 Input
1 Output
-
81849c052629809bc95ea2194af31e59a95b3e77b9fd7f4eec3ce849a23b9643:0
- value
- 150899445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a64540f0f1e47fea69a1457c3d7cedc91dc4b70 OP_EQUAL
- address
- MAJhzMVNWyctNeGk4hKZjeduihe8tsmzn7